-enum HotlineTransactionFieldType: UInt16 {
- case errorText = 100 // String
- case data = 101 // String
- case userName = 102 // String
- case userID = 103 // Integer
- case userIconID = 104 // Integer
- case userLogin = 105 // Encoded string
- case userPassword = 106 // Encoded string
- case referenceNumber = 107 // Integer
- case transferSize = 108 // Integer
- case chatOptions = 109 // Integer
- case userAccess = 110 // 64-bit integer?
- case userAlias = 111 // ???
- case userFlags = 112 // Integer
- case options = 113 // 32-bit integer?
- case chatID = 114 // Integer
- case chatSubject = 115 // String
- case waitingCount = 116 // Integer
- case serverAgreement = 150 // ???
- case serverBanner = 151 // Data?
- case serverBannerType = 152 // Integer
- case serverBannerURL = 153 // String
- case noServerAgreement = 154 // Integer
- case versionNumber = 160 // Integer
- case communityBannerID = 161 // Integer
- case serverName = 162 // String
- // TODO: Add file field types
- case quotingMessage = 214 // String?
- case automaticResponse = 215 // String
- case folderItemCount = 220 // Integer
- case userNameWithInfo = 300 // Data { user id: 2, icon id: 2, user flags: 2, user name size: 2, user name: size }
- case newsCategoryGUID = 319 // Data?
- case newsCategoryListData = 320 // Data { type: 1 (1 = folder, 10 = category, 255 = other), category name: rest }
- case newsArticleListData = 321 // Data
- case newsCategoryName = 322 // String
- case newsCategoryListData15 = 323 // Data
- case newsPath = 325 // Data
- case newsArticleID = 326 // Integer
- case newsArticleDataFlavor = 327 // String
- case newsArticleTitle = 328 // String
- case newsArticlePoster = 329 // String
- case newsArticleDate = 330 // Data { year: 2, ms: 2, secs: 4 }
- case newsArticlePrevious = 331 // Integer
- case newsArticleNext = 332 // Integer
- case newsArticleData = 333 // Data
- case newsArticleFlags = 334 // Integer
- case newsArticleParentArticle = 335 // Integer
- case newsArticleFirstChildArticle = 336 // Integer
- case newsArticleRecursiveDelete = 337 // Integer
-}

-enum HotlineTransactionType: UInt16 {
- case reply = 0
- case error = 100
- case getMessages = 101
- case newMessage = 102 // Server
- case oldPostNews = 103
- case serverMessage = 104 // Server
- case sendChat = 105
- case chatMessage = 106 // Server
- case login = 107
- case sendInstantMessage = 108
- case showAgreement = 109 // Server
- case disconnectUser = 110
- case disconnectMessage = 111 // Server
- case inviteToNewChat = 112
- case inviteToChat = 113 // Server
- case rejectChatInvite = 114
- case joinChat = 115
- case leaveChat = 116
- case notifyChatOfUserChange = 117 // Server
- case notifyChatOfUserDelete = 118 // Server
- case notifyChatSubject = 119 // Server
- case setChatSubject = 120
- case agreed = 121
- case serverBanner = 122 // Server
- case getFileNameList = 200
- case downloadFile = 202
- case uploadFile = 203
- case deleteFile = 204
- case newFolder = 205
- case getFileInfo = 206
- case setFileInfo = 207
- case moveFile = 208
- case makeFileAlias = 209
- case downloadFolder = 210
- case downloadInfo = 211 // Server
- case downloadBanner = 212
- case uploadFolder = 213
- case getUserNameList = 300
- case notifyOfUserChange = 301 // Server
- case notifyOfUserDelete = 302 // Server
- case getClientInfoText = 303
- case setClientUserInfo = 304
- case newUser = 350
- case deleteUser = 351
- case getUser = 352
- case setUser = 353
- case userAccess = 354 // Server
- case userBroadcast = 355 // Client & Server
- case getNewsCategoryNameList = 370
- case getNewsArticleNameList = 371
- case deleteNewsItem = 380
- case newNewsFolder = 381
- case newNewsCategory = 382
- case getNewsArticleData = 400
- case postNewsArticle = 410
- case deleteNewsArticle = 411
- case connectionKeepAlive = 500
-}
